What Makes Cranberry Extract Effective?
Cranberries contain natural compounds called proanthocyanidins, which have antioxidant properties. These compounds may help to reduce the ability of certain bacteria to adhere to the urinary tract lining, thereby supporting a healthy urinary environment. Additionally, cranberry’s antioxidant content contributes to overall cellular health. For dogs prone to urinary imbalances, incorporating cranberry extract can be a proactive step towards maintaining comfort and wellbeing.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are these chewables safe for all dogs?
Cranberry supplements are generally considered safe for most dogs when given as directed. However, dogs with certain health conditions (like kidney disease or diabetes) should only uses them under veterinary supervision. Always consult your vet before starting any new supplement regimen.
How long does it take to see results?
Results may vary depending on your dog’s individual needs. Some owners report noticing improvements in urinary habits within a few weeks. Consistent daily uses is recommended for best results.
Can these chewables replace veterinary treatment?
No. These chewables are a dietary supplement intended to support general health. They are not a medication and should not be used to treat or any medical condition. If your dog shows signs of urinary distress, such as bloody urine or straining, consult a veterinarian immediately.
